[quote="judgej"]My point was the statement along the lines of "we are not going to support our product being subordinate to any other product" went against the spirit that I personally attribute to the GPL. [/quote]I think that you are misquoting him.  What he was saying was more along the lines of "We are not going to subordinate our project to another project."  

I think that you would get more developer support if you started talking about how to link in other theme managers in *general*, rather than trying to talk them into dropping 80% of their codebase in favor of someone else's with which they're not familiar.

I don't think that they should do anything like that, any more than KDE should drop Konqueror and build Phoenix/Firebird/whatever into their WM.  Or that Linux should build KDE into the kernel.  Or to enhance performance, Linux could custom code the kernel in AMD specific machine code only.   Or so on and so forth.  A great deal of the idea behind open source is choice.  By contrast, while your proposal would make *your* choice easier, it would then preclude a lot of others from making their own choices.
